M&G Investments (M&G) has appointed Jen Braswell as global head of impact for its £83bn private markets business.
Overall, M&G has £13.8bn under its impact platform, with Braswell's appointment strengthening the firm's ability to originate, manage and scale these investments for institutions, the manager said.
The hire builds on the firm's aim to provide clients with access to opportunities across private credit, infrastructure, real assets and private equity in developed and emerging markets, with a focus on climate, financial inclusion, sustainable food systems and social infrastructure.

'Institutional investors increasingly want private markets strategies that can combine financial performance with clear, measurable impact,' said Emmanuel Deblanc, chief investment officer, private markets at M&G Investments, to whom Braswell will report.
'Jen's appointment brings greater strategic focus to our approach as we accelerate product innovation, deepen partnerships and strengthen how we can deliver impact for clients at scale.'

Since January 2026, Braswell has served as senior impact adviser to M&G's specialist emerging markets investing business, responsAbility, helping to enhance its capabilities across the firm's private markets platform and scale its impact offering.
In her new role, she will continue to advise the responsAbility executive management team on impact-related topics.
Prior to joining M&G, Braswell was managing director of global impact at EQT. Before that, she held senior leadership roles at British International Investment.
